Royal Palace of Naples

The Royal Palace of Naples (in Italian: Palazzo Reale di Napoli) is a historic building located in the Plebiscito square, in the historic center of Naples. Although it is in this square where the main entrance is located, there are other accesses to the complex, which also includes the San Carlos gardens and theater, from Piazza Trieste e Trento, Piazza del Municipio and Via Acton.
The palace was the residence of the Spanish viceroys and after the Bourbon dynasty for more than a hundred years, from 1734 to 1861, first as kings of Naples and Sicily (1734-1816) and later as kings of the Two Sicilies (1816- 1861). This Bourbon use was interrupted only for a decade at the beginning of the 19th century, with French rule and the government of José Bonaparte and Joaquín Murat (1806-1815). After the Italian Unification (1861) it passed to the Savoy, until Victor Manuel III ceded it to the State in 1919. Then, the palace was opened to the public and its western half went to house the Museum of the Royal Apartment , while the east became the headquarters of the National Library, uses that continue today.
The construction of the Royal Palace began in 1600, until it reached its final appearance in 1858. In its construction and in the subsequent restorations numerous renowned architects such as Domenico Fontana, Francesco Antonio Picchiatti, Ferdinando Sanfelice, Luigi Vanvitelli and Gaetano Genovese have participated.

San Carlos Theater

The San Carlos Theater (Teatro di San Carlo in Italian) is the most important theater in Naples and one of the most famous in the world. Opened on November 4, 1737, it is the oldest active opera house in the world. Due to its size and structure, it has been the model of the following theaters in Europe.

Conservatory of San Pietro a Maiella

The San Pietro a Maiella Conservatory is a music conservatory in Naples. Its headquarters are in the center of the city, in the convent of the Celestinians, attached to the church of San Pietro a Maiella (Via San Pietro a Majella 35).

University of Naples Frederick II

The University of Naples Federico II (in Italian: Università degli Studi di Napoli Federico II) is the main Neapolitan university and one of the most important in Italy. It is the oldest lay and state university in the world since it was founded in 1224.

Plebiscite Square

The Piazza del Plebiscito (in Italian Piazza del Plebiscito and, in the past, Largo di Palazzo or Foro Regio), is a square in Naples, Italy.
Located in the heart of the city, with an area of about 25,000 square meters, the square overlooks some of the most important historical buildings in Naples:

the Royal Palace;
the Basilica of San Francisco de Paula;
the Palace of the Prefecture;
the Salerno Palace.
